Dual-strengthening micro-oil ignition and flame stabilizer with oxygen combustion supporting

2009 
The utility model discloses a dual-strengthening micro-oil ignition and flame stabilizer with oxygen combustion supporting, comprising an impact coal dust concentration fractional combustion coal burner, a main micro-oil gun, a front micro-oil gun, and an oxygen combustion supporting sprayer nozzle arranged in a surrounding way, wherein the main micro-oil gun and the front micro-oil gun adopt double helix pneumatic nebulization structures; the main micro-oil gun and the coal burner adopt coaxial assembly structure; the front micro-oil gun is installed on an outer-layer combustor with a 20-60-degree included angle with the axis of the coal burner; an inner-layer combustor and the outer-layer combustor are respectively and evenly distributed with a ring of oxygen pipes in the peripheral direction; when in ignition and flame stabilizing, the combustion flame of the main micro-oil gun is used to light the coal dust in the inner-layer combustor, then the heat emitted by the coal dust combustion in the inner-layer combustor lights the coal dust in the outer-layer combustor; and when the coal dust has poor quality and is hard to be lighted, the oxygen is conveyed to the inner-layer combustor and the outer-layer combustor through an oxygen sprayer pipe, and simultaneously, the outer-layer combustor uses the front micro-oil gun to conduct secondary heating on the coal dust airflow, thus ensuring the reliable ignition and stable combustion of the coal dust airflow. The device is especially applicable to lighting of coal with lower volatile matter content such as soft coal, meagre coal, blind coal and the like as well as petroleum coke and other fuels.
